fishfingersandchipsagain · 14/08/2025 20:16

I stopped faffing and placed the Amazon Haul order. They must be losing money on it to get the business. I ordered 41 items for £25 including delivery. I ended up with an additional 10% discount when the “full price” basket got to (I think) £50, so 80% off.

Lots of good stocking fillers type stuff - teenage boys in our house so precision screwdriver set (36p), mini monacular telescope (54p), belt (32p), RFID card wallet (76p), manicure set (15p) etc (all prices after the 80% discount)

I also got things for me that I was otherwise going to buy at “normal prices”, like sleep bras, yoga shorts, drawer dividers etc.
